Transaction 46ddebeaf61dc0d28182ecd23bdfda2140acace38fe1013ea5fdfeb239000e24
1 Input
1 Output
-
46ddebeaf61dc0d28182ecd23bdfda2140acace38fe1013ea5fdfeb239000e24:0
- value
- 1145669
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9b0909626fd73d20f7ce2f2c9fc31b619560e79a2412ce5d4549319a8eee4a9e
- address
- bc1pnvysjcn06u7jpa7w9ukflscmvx2kpeu6ysfvuh29fyce4rhwf20q392f4h